Assessing the Many Management Challenges George Faces
Having stepped into Stevenson Company transportation department as its new supervisor, George is quickly overwhelmed by a department in disarray, chaotically operating without any leadership or guidance. The major management issues George faces is predicated on the lack of clarity regarding roles, authority and organization structure and clarity of performance expectations. In short, the management issues George faces are what happens when senior management abdicates leadership of a given area of a business, allowing personal agendas and resentment to ester instead of implementing clear performance expectations. The lack of willingness to change and improve is more attributable the managers of dysfunctional teams than the teams themselves (James, Wooten, Dushek, 2011).
The first and most significant management issue is getting the transportation department integrated back into the company. The many symptoms of its malaise and dysfunctional nature can be attributed to its lack of leadership and intently. When organizational teams lack a sense of identity and meaning, the tendency to pursue individual agendas and ideas becomes a higher priority than accomplishing the goals of a department or organizational unit (Jaques, 2012). This is what's happening with the many symptoms of a department gradually disintegrating. Everyone is thinking about themselves first, not even considering the mission and objectives of the department itself. Left unchecked there will be a degradation in service and the broader company's financial performance and customer relationships will seriously suffer.
